What is 9/5 of 42?

Often, in mathematics or everyday life, we need to find a fraction of a given number. For instance, how would you quickly calculate 9/5 of 42? We'll show you a straightforward method to achieve that.

How to calculate 9/5 of 42?

  1. Multiply the whole number by the numerator of the fraction: 42 × 9 = 378
  2. Divide this result by denominator of the fraction: 378/5 = 75.6

Since 378/5 is an improper fraction, the result could also be expressed as a mixed number: 75 3/5

How does it work?

The principle behind finding a fraction of a number, such as 9/5 of 42, is rooted in the method of cross-multiplication.

Consider the following proportion: 9 5 = x 42 (where x represents 9/5 of 42)

  1. Using the cross-multiplication method, multiply both numerators by their opposite denominators: 9 × 42 = 5 x
  2. Which gives: 378 = 5 x
  3. Divide both sides by 5 to isolate x: 378 5 = 5 x 5
  4. Which gives the result: 378 5 = x

Thus, 9/5 of 42 is equal to 378/5 (or 75.6 in its decimal form).
